Module: Dependabot::RustToolchain

Defined in:
lib/dependabot/rust_toolchain.rb,
lib/dependabot/rust_toolchain/channel.rb,
lib/dependabot/rust_toolchain/version.rb,
lib/dependabot/rust_toolchain/file_parser.rb,
lib/dependabot/rust_toolchain/requirement.rb,
lib/dependabot/rust_toolchain/channel_type.rb,
lib/dependabot/rust_toolchain/file_fetcher.rb,
lib/dependabot/rust_toolchain/file_updater.rb,
lib/dependabot/rust_toolchain/channel_parser.rb,
lib/dependabot/rust_toolchain/update_checker.rb,
lib/dependabot/rust_toolchain/metadata_finder.rb,
lib/dependabot/rust_toolchain/package_manager.rb,
lib/dependabot/rust_toolchain/models/rust_toolchain_toml.rb,
lib/dependabot/rust_toolchain/models/rust_toolchain_config.rb,
lib/dependabot/rust_toolchain/package/package_details_fetcher.rb,
lib/dependabot/rust_toolchain/update_checker/latest_version_finder.rb

Defined Under Namespace

Modules: Models, Package Classes: Channel, ChannelParser, ChannelType, FileFetcher, FileParser, FileUpdater, MetadataFinder, Requirement, RustToolchainPackageManager, UpdateChecker, Version

Constant Summary collapse

RUST_TOOLCHAIN_TOML_FILENAME =
"rust-toolchain.toml"
RUST_TOOLCHAIN_FILENAME =
"rust-toolchain"
STABLE_CHANNEL =
"stable"
BETA_CHANNEL =
"beta"
NIGHTLY_CHANNEL =
"nightly"
RUST_GITHUB_URL =
"https://github.com/rust-lang/rust"
ECOSYSTEM =
"rust"
PACKAGE_MANAGER =
"rustup"
SUPPORTED_VERSIONS =
T.let([].freeze, T::Array[Dependabot::Version])
DEPRECATED_VERSIONS =
T.let([].freeze, T::Array[Dependabot::Version])